本文目录导读:
在计算机科学领域,关系数据库作为一种重要的数据存储与管理方式,被广泛应用于各种场景,关系数据库的核心在于其基本的数据结构,主要包括表、行、列与主键等,本文将深入探讨这些基本数据结构,帮助读者更好地理解关系数据库的运作原理。
表(Table)
表是关系数据库中最基本的数据结构,它由行和列组成,每个表都包含一个或多个行,每行代表一条记录,每列代表记录中的一个属性,表可以看作是一个二维表格,其中行对应于表格的行,列对应于表格的列,一个学生信息表可以包含姓名、年龄、性别、班级等属性。
行(Row)
行是表中的基本数据单元,它代表了一条记录,每条记录都是表中的一个实例,包含所有列的属性值,在关系数据库中,行具有唯一性,即每条记录的属性值组合是唯一的,在一个学生信息表中,每行代表一个学生的具体信息。
列(Column)
列是表中的属性,它表示记录中的一个属性值,每列都有一个数据类型,用于指定该列中存储的数据类型,在学生信息表中,姓名列的数据类型可能是字符串,年龄列的数据类型可能是整数,性别列的数据类型可能是字符。
图片来源于网络,如有侵权联系删除
主键(Primary Key)
主键是表中唯一标识每条记录的属性或属性组合,在关系数据库中,每个表都应该有一个主键,以确保记录的唯一性,主键可以是单个列,也可以是多个列的组合,在一个学生信息表中,学生ID可以作为主键,因为每个学生的ID都是唯一的。
关系数据库基本数据结构的应用
1、数据查询:通过SQL(结构化查询语言)对关系数据库进行查询,可以方便地检索、筛选和排序数据,查询年龄大于18岁的学生信息。
2、数据更新:在关系数据库中,可以对表中的数据进行增、删、改等操作,更新某个学生的年龄信息。
图片来源于网络,如有侵权联系删除
3、数据完整性:关系数据库通过主键、外键等约束机制,确保数据的完整性,通过外键约束,可以防止删除一个记录时影响到其他相关记录。
4、数据安全性:关系数据库提供用户认证、权限管理等机制,确保数据的安全性。
5、数据一致性:关系数据库通过事务机制,保证数据的一致性,在进行多步操作时,要么全部成功,要么全部失败。
图片来源于网络,如有侵权联系删除
关系数据库中的基本数据结构——表、行、列与主键,是数据库设计、开发和应用的基础,理解这些数据结构有助于我们更好地运用关系数据库,实现高效、安全、可靠的数据管理,在实际应用中,我们需要根据具体需求,合理设计表结构,选择合适的主键,以确保数据的准确性和完整性。
标签: #关系数据库中基本的数据结构是
评论列表